IP查询
查询
你查询的IP:[202.38.175.228] 地理位置:印度
最新查询
210.15.253.27
121.192.4.212
117.48.89.170
124.242.52.7
202.70.235.42
220.192.82.159
120.48.219.22
122.112.1.21
122.96.136.174
202.38.175.228
210.26.65.243
210.51.50.172
125.171.48.17
118.88.64.110
123.4.50.195
123.52.162.151
117.103.16.240
203.99.80.230
58.66.250.234
218.64.227.158
203.100.32.0
116.242.42.167
202.38.156.31
202.14.236.224
117.124.153.58
202.38.128.116
211.96.184.33
120.76.59.21
122.198.201.249
59.64.201.237
202.127.16.62